Toyota Estima Engine Capacity: Complete Engine Size Guide

When we talk about the Toyota Estima engine capacity, one simple number does not tell the whole story. Toyota produced the Estima across several generations, and during its long lifespan the Japanese minivan used everything from unusual mid-mounted four-cylinder engines to smooth V6 petrol units and sophisticated hybrid powertrains.
Depending on the generation and specification, the Toyota Estima came with engines ranging primarily from 2.4 litres to 3.5 litres. The first generation used a 2,438 cc four-cylinder engine, while later versions offered 2,362 cc four-cylinder, 2,994 cc V6 and 3,456 cc V6 engines. Hybrid models also relied on a 2.4-litre petrol engine combined with electric motors. Toyota's own historical specifications confirm these capacities across the major generations.
But engine capacity is only part of the equation. A 2.4-litre Estima Hybrid behaves very differently from a conventional 2.4-litre petrol version, while the 3.5-litre V6 transforms the minivan into something surprisingly quick for a family vehicle.

Toyota Estima Engine Capacity at a Glance
Before digging into each generation, here is the easiest way to understand the main Toyota Estima engine sizes.
| Estima version | Approx. engine capacity | Exact displacement | Configuration |
|---|---|---|---|
| First generation petrol | 2.4L | 2,438 cc | Inline-four |
| Second generation petrol | 2.4L | 2,362 cc | Inline-four |
| Second generation V6 | 3.0L | 2,994 cc | V6 |
| Second generation Hybrid | 2.4L | 2,362 cc | Inline-four + electric motors |
| Third generation petrol | 2.4L | 2,362 cc | Inline-four |
| Third generation V6 | 3.5L | 3,456 cc | V6 |
| Third generation Hybrid | 2.4L | 2,362 cc | Inline-four + electric motors |
Toyota's historical records show that the second-generation Estima offered both the 2,362 cc 2AZ-FE and 2,994 cc 1MZ-FE, while the third generation moved to 2,362 cc and 3,456 cc petrol options.
That means most shoppers researching a used Estima today will encounter 2.4L, 3.0L or 3.5L engines, plus 2.4L hybrid variants.
What Does Toyota Estima Engine Capacity Mean?
Engine capacity—also called displacement—represents the total volume swept by all the pistons inside the cylinders.
A Toyota Estima advertised as a "2.4" does not necessarily have exactly 2,400 cc.
For example, the widely used Toyota 2AZ engine has an actual displacement of 2,362 cc, although manufacturers and sellers naturally round that figure to 2.4 litres. Toyota's first-generation 2TZ engine was slightly larger at 2,438 cc, yet it was also marketed as a 2.4-litre engine.
Think of engine capacity like the size of a pair of lungs. Larger capacity generally allows an engine to move more air and fuel with each combustion cycle. That can provide more torque and power, although modern engine design means capacity alone cannot tell us how strong or efficient an engine will be.
Is 2.4L Really 2400cc?
Not exactly.
In most Toyota Estima specifications, "2.4L" refers to approximately 2.4 litres rather than precisely 2,400 cc.
The common figures are:
- 2.4L first-generation engine: 2,438 cc
- 2.4L later petrol engine: 2,362 cc
- 2.4L hybrid engine: 2,362 cc
- 3.0L V6: 2,994 cc
- 3.5L V6: 3,456 cc
This explains why different websites may show slightly different-looking numbers while actually describing the same engine.
First-Generation Toyota Estima Engine Capacity
The original Toyota Estima arrived in Japan in 1990, and it was unlike almost anything else in Toyota's lineup.
Instead of simply placing the engine conventionally at the front, Toyota installed its four-cylinder engine beneath the floor at a steep angle. Toyota describes the engine as being tilted approximately 75 degrees, a layout that helped create the Estima's famously spacious and futuristic "egg-shaped" body.
First-Generation 2.4-Litre Engine
The original Estima used the 2TZ-FE, an inline-four petrol engine with:
Engine capacity: 2,438 cc
Rounded capacity: 2.4 litres
Configuration: Inline-four
Valve system: DOHC
Original quoted output: 135 PS
Toyota's historical specifications list exactly 2,438 cc for both rear-wheel-drive and four-wheel-drive versions of the original model.
The capacity sounds ordinary today, but the engine installation certainly was not.
Why Was the First Estima Engine So Unusual?
Packaging.
Toyota wanted a large passenger compartment without building a giant van. Putting the engine under the floor helped free up interior space and contributed to the Estima's distinctive silhouette.
It was clever engineering, although clever engineering can sometimes become interesting engineering when maintenance day arrives.
Toyota abandoned the underfloor mid-engine configuration after this generation and adopted a conventional front-engine arrangement for subsequent Estimas.
Supercharged 2.4-Litre Estima
Toyota later added a supercharged version of the 2.4-litre powerplant.
Toyota's historical account notes that the initial naturally aspirated engine produced 135 PS and that a 160 PS supercharged engine joined the range in 1994.
This is a useful reminder that two engines with essentially the same capacity can provide noticeably different performance.
Capacity tells us the size of the engine.
It does not tell us the entire personality of the vehicle.
Second-Generation Toyota Estima Engine Capacity
The second generation arrived in 2000 and represented a major mechanical change.
Toyota abandoned the original underfloor engine arrangement and switched to a conventional front-engine layout. That decision gave engineers more freedom when choosing engines, and buyers suddenly had considerably more variety.
The principal petrol choices became:
2.4-litre inline-four
and
3.0-litre V6
Then Toyota added something genuinely important: the Estima Hybrid.
Toyota Estima 2.4 Engine Capacity
One of the most common engines in the Estima family is Toyota's 2AZ-FE.
Its actual displacement is:
2,362 cc, or approximately 2.4 litres.
Toyota fitted this engine to the second-generation Estima and continued using the 2.4-litre format in the third generation. Toyota's specifications for the 2000 model list the 2AZ-FE as a four-cylinder DOHC engine producing 160 PS in representative Japanese-market specification.
Why Was the 2.4L Engine Popular?
Because it sits near the middle of the practical sweet spot.
A family minivan needs enough power to carry passengers, luggage and occasionally a very ambitious supermarket run. At the same time, many owners do not need the additional displacement of a V6.
The 2.4-litre therefore offers an appealing balance between:
- Reasonable engine size
- Adequate everyday performance
- Lower fuel appetite than a large V6 in many driving conditions
- Four-cylinder mechanical simplicity
- Broad availability in the used-import market
It is not the dramatic choice.
It is the sensible pair of shoes you somehow end up wearing five days a week.
Toyota Estima 3.0 V6 Engine Capacity
Want more cylinders?
Second-generation buyers could choose the 1MZ-FE 3.0-litre V6.
Toyota lists its exact displacement as 2,994 cc and its output at 220 PS in representative Japanese-market Estima specifications.
That gave the large minivan a noticeably different character.
2.4 vs 3.0 Toyota Estima
The difference is not simply 632 cc.
The 2.4 uses four cylinders, whereas the 3.0 uses six. That changes the way the vehicle delivers its performance.
The 2.4L generally appeals to drivers prioritizing everyday running costs and mechanical practicality. The 3.0L appeals to drivers who value smoother power delivery and stronger performance, especially with passengers aboard.
Imagine two people carrying the same sofa upstairs. One gets the job done. The other does it without looking quite as annoyed.
That roughly describes the difference.
Second-Generation Toyota Estima Hybrid Engine Capacity
In June 2001 Toyota expanded the Estima range with the Estima Hybrid.
Its petrol engine remained a 2.4-litre four-cylinder unit, but it was not simply the regular 2AZ-FE with some batteries thrown into the boot.
Toyota used the 2AZ-FXE, developed for hybrid operation.
Toyota specifications list:
Engine: 2AZ-FXE
Capacity: 2,362 cc
Layout: Inline-four DOHC
Petrol engine output: 131 PS in the original version
Does the Electric Motor Increase Engine Capacity?
No.
This causes plenty of confusion.
A hybrid Toyota Estima may use electric motors in addition to the petrol engine, but the electric motors do not increase the engine's cubic capacity.
The internal-combustion engine remains 2,362 cc.
Electric assistance affects the vehicle's total powertrain performance, not the displacement of the petrol engine.
So when someone asks, "What cc is an Estima Hybrid?" the simplest answer is:
2,362 cc, or 2.4 litres.
Third-Generation Toyota Estima Engine Capacity
Toyota completely redesigned the Estima again for 2006.

At launch, Toyota offered two principal conventional petrol engines:
2.4-litre four-cylinder
3.5-litre V6
Toyota specifically described the redesigned Estima as offering an improved 2.4-litre four-cylinder 2AZ-FE and a high-performance 3.5-litre V6 2GR-FE.
Third-Generation Toyota Estima 2.4 Capacity
Once again, the regular four-cylinder Estima used the 2AZ-FE.
The exact capacity remained:
2,362 cc
Toyota's historical specification database lists the third-generation 2.4L Aeras with the 2AZ-FE inline-four engine and 2,362 cc displacement.
This became one of the defining Estima configurations.
Is the 2.4 Estima Powerful Enough?
For normal family driving, generally yes.
We should remember what the Estima actually is. It was never intended to behave like a lightweight sports coupe. It is a spacious multi-passenger vehicle designed around comfort and usability.
A 2.4-litre Estima may feel busier when heavily loaded or accelerating hard than a V6 version, but engine capacity should be judged in relation to how we intend to use the vehicle.
Mostly city driving?
School runs?
Family trips?
Moderate motorway driving?
The 2.4 can make plenty of sense.
Want effortless acceleration with seven people and luggage aboard?
Now the V6 becomes much more tempting.
Toyota Estima 3.5 V6 Engine Capacity
This is the big one.
Third-generation Estimas could be equipped with Toyota's 2GR-FE 3.5-litre V6.
The actual engine capacity is:
3,456 cc
Toyota lists the 2GR-FE as a V6 DOHC engine and gives a displacement of exactly 3,456 cc. Representative 3.5-litre Estima specifications were rated at up to 280 PS.
For a family minivan, that is substantial muscle.
How Different Is the 3.5L Estima?
Very.
The V6 provides substantially more performance potential than the 2.4-litre four-cylinder.
It turns the Estima from a vehicle that simply transports the family into something that can accelerate with surprising enthusiasm.
Floor the throttle and the big Toyota suddenly remembers it has a 3.5-litre V6 hiding beneath its family-friendly body.
Of course, power has a price.
More capacity and performance can mean greater fuel consumption, while six-cylinder vehicles can carry different servicing and ownership considerations from the four-cylinder alternatives.
Third-Generation Toyota Estima Hybrid Engine Capacity
Toyota also launched a redesigned Estima Hybrid in 2006.
Once again, the heart of the hybrid system was a 2,362 cc 2AZ-FXE four-cylinder petrol engine.
Toyota's technical information for the 2006 model identifies the 2AZ-FXE, 2,362 cc displacement and 150 PS petrol-engine output, working within Toyota's THS II hybrid system.
Electric motors supplemented the petrol engine, including the E-Four electrically assisted four-wheel-drive arrangement.
Why Can a 2.4 Hybrid Feel Different From a 2.4 Petrol?
Because displacement is only one ingredient.
Think of the petrol engine as one musician in a band. In the conventional Estima, it performs most of the song itself. In the Hybrid, electric motors join the performance.
The petrol engine can therefore operate differently while electric assistance contributes to propulsion.
That is why comparing the two vehicles exclusively by saying "both are 2.4 litres" misses an important part of the story.
Toyota Estima Engine Codes Explained
Engine codes are extremely useful when buying parts or researching an imported Estima.
The most important codes include:
2TZ-FE
Found in the first-generation Estima.
Capacity: 2,438 cc
It is a naturally aspirated inline-four and belongs to the unusual underfloor-engine era of the Estima.
2AZ-FE
One of the most common Estima petrol engines.
Capacity: 2,362 cc
It appears in both second- and third-generation conventional petrol models.
1MZ-FE
The second-generation V6.
Capacity: 2,994 cc
Toyota used it to give the Estima more effortless performance than the four-cylinder alternative.
2GR-FE
The third-generation performance heavyweight.
Capacity: 3,456 cc
This naturally aspirated V6 gave some Estima variants up to 280 PS in Toyota's representative specifications.
2AZ-FXE
The hybrid-focused 2.4-litre engine.
Capacity: 2,362 cc
Toyota used the 2AZ-FXE in Estima Hybrid models rather than the regular 2AZ-FE.
Toyota Estima 2.4 vs 3.5: Which Is Better?
This is probably the comparison that matters most to buyers looking at later Estimas.
The answer depends entirely on what we expect from the vehicle.
Choose the 2.4L If You Value Practicality
The 2.4-litre engine makes sense for drivers who prioritize normal family use over outright performance.
Its strengths include manageable performance, widespread availability and a straightforward four-cylinder layout.
For urban driving and everyday transportation, a healthy 2.4 can be all the Estima most families require.
Choose the 3.5L If You Value Performance
If performance matters more, the 3.5-litre V6 wins easily.
The extra capacity and two additional cylinders provide a much stronger power reserve.
It becomes particularly attractive when the vehicle frequently carries several adults, luggage or travels at motorway speeds.
But we should ask ourselves a simple question:
How often are we actually going to use that extra performance?
If the answer is "constantly," the V6 has a compelling case.

Toyota Estima Hybrid vs Petrol Engine Capacity
Here is another interesting comparison.
Both a conventional four-cylinder Estima and an Estima Hybrid can be described as having a 2.4-litre engine, and both later versions use engines with 2,362 cc displacement.
Yet they are fundamentally different powertrains.
The conventional vehicle uses the 2AZ-FE.
The Hybrid uses the 2AZ-FXE plus electric assistance. Toyota's 2006 hybrid specification confirms that its 2,362 cc petrol engine works as part of the THS II hybrid arrangement.
So shoppers should never assume two 2.4-litre Estimas are mechanically identical.
Does Bigger Engine Capacity Mean Higher Fuel Consumption?
Often, but not automatically.
A larger engine has the potential to burn more fuel because it can process more air and fuel. Yet real-world consumption depends on far more than displacement.
Vehicle weight, gearing, traffic, speed, driving habits, mechanical condition, tyre pressure and drivetrain specification can all affect consumption.
A driver constantly flooring a 2.4 may see surprisingly high fuel use, while someone gently cruising in a larger engine may produce a smaller difference than expected.
Engine capacity gives us a clue.
It does not hand us the final fuel bill.
Which Toyota Estima Engine Is Best for City Driving?
For predominantly urban driving, we would generally look toward the 2.4-litre petrol or 2.4-litre hybrid rather than choosing the 3.5 V6 purely for its performance.
The hybrid is particularly interesting because electric assistance is built into its operating strategy.
However, with older imported hybrid vehicles, buying purely according to fuel economy can be a mistake. Battery health and the overall condition of the hybrid system matter significantly.
A cheap neglected hybrid can quickly erase whatever money we hoped to save at the fuel pump.
Condition first.
Specification second.
Which Toyota Estima Engine Is Best for Highway Driving?
For drivers who frequently tackle longer, faster journeys, the 3.5-litre V6 has an obvious attraction.
Its extra power can make overtaking, merging and carrying heavy passenger loads feel more relaxed.
The 3.0-litre V6 in second-generation models provides a similar philosophy, although it belongs to an older generation.
Still, a well-maintained 2.4 remains perfectly capable of highway driving.
We should not confuse "less powerful" with "incapable."
How to Check Your Toyota Estima Engine Capacity
Never rely entirely on a classified advertisement.
Used-car advertisements are not sacred documents. Sellers make mistakes, registration information can be confusing, and imported vehicles sometimes change hands several times before reaching us.
The safest approach is to verify the vehicle itself.
Check:
- The engine code on the identification information.
- The chassis or model code.
- Registration documents.
- The VIN or Japanese chassis number where applicable.
- Service records and parts invoices.
For example, seeing 2AZ-FE points toward the conventional 2.4-litre engine, while 2GR-FE identifies the 3.5-litre V6.
That is far more useful than trusting a listing that simply says "Toyota Estima automatic."
Does Engine Capacity Affect Estima Maintenance?
Absolutely.
Different engines require different quantities of fluids, different components and potentially different maintenance procedures.
A four-cylinder 2AZ-FE and a 3.5-litre 2GR-FE should never be treated as though they were interchangeable just because they were installed in the same minivan.
Engine capacity can influence factors such as:
- Fuel consumption
- Oil requirements
- Spark plug quantity
- Cooling-system workload
- Parts pricing
- Insurance or taxation in some markets
- Performance
- Overall servicing costs
That is why identifying the engine before ordering parts is so important.

Toyota Estima Engine Capacity by Generation
If we strip everything down to the essentials, the Estima's engine evolution looks like this.
First Generation: 1990–1999
The first Estima centered around a 2.4-litre four-cylinder, with Toyota listing its original 2TZ-FE displacement at 2,438 cc. A more powerful supercharged version appeared later.
Second Generation: From 2000
Toyota dramatically broadened the engine range.
Buyers could get a 2,362 cc 2.4-litre four-cylinder or 2,994 cc 3.0-litre V6, while the Estima Hybrid introduced a 2,362 cc hybrid-specific 2AZ-FXE petrol engine with electric assistance.
Third Generation: From 2006
The 2.4-litre engine continued, but Toyota replaced the 3.0 V6 option with a far more powerful 3,456 cc 3.5-litre V6. The redesigned Hybrid continued using a 2,362 cc petrol engine within its hybrid system.

Frequently Asked Questions
1. What is the engine capacity of a Toyota Estima?
Toyota Estima engine capacity depends on the generation. Major versions include 2.4-litre, 3.0-litre and 3.5-litre petrol engines. The actual capacities include 2,438 cc, 2,362 cc, 2,994 cc and 3,456 cc depending on engine and model year.
2. What is the engine capacity of the Toyota Estima Hybrid?
The major Toyota Estima Hybrid generations use a 2,362 cc—or approximately 2.4-litre—petrol engine combined with electric motors. Toyota used the hybrid-specific 2AZ-FXE engine.
3. Is the Toyota Estima 2.4 a four-cylinder engine?
Yes. Later conventional 2.4-litre Toyota Estimas use the 2AZ-FE inline-four engine with 2,362 cc displacement. The original first-generation Estima also used a four-cylinder 2.4-litre engine, although its 2TZ-FE displaced 2,438 cc.
4. What is the biggest Toyota Estima engine?
Among the principal production Estima powertrains, the largest is the 3.5-litre 2GR-FE V6, with an exact displacement of 3,456 cc. Toyota offered it in the third-generation Estima.
5. Is the Toyota Estima 2.4 or 3.5 better?
The 2.4L is generally the more practical choice for drivers focused on everyday family transportation, while the 3.5L V6 provides considerably stronger performance. Neither is automatically better; vehicle condition, maintenance history, driving requirements and operating costs should guide the decision.
